US Flock Adhesives Market Summary

As per Market Research Future analysis, the US flock adhesives market size was estimated at 495.88 USD Million in 2024. The US flock adhesives market is projected to grow from 519.78 USD Million in 2025 to 832.44 USD Million by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 4.8% during the forecast period 2025 - 2035

By Source: Waterborne (Largest) vs. Solvent-borne (Fastest-Growing)

In the US flock adhesives market, waterborne adhesives hold a significant share due to their eco-friendly properties and lower volatile organic compound (VOC) emissions. This segment benefits from increasing regulatory support encouraging companies to adopt greener alternatives. In contrast, solvent-borne adhesives, while currently smaller in market share, are rapidly gaining traction as industries seek more robust bonding solutions, particularly in demanding applications where performance is paramount. The growth trends in these segments reflect a broader shift towards sustainability in adhesive formulations. Waterborne adhesives are preferred in sectors such as textiles and packaging due to their environmental advantages. Meanwhile, solvent-borne adhesives are witnessing a revival in certain markets, driven by innovations that enhance their performance characteristics, such as improved adhesion and drying times, making them more appealing to manufacturers striving for efficiency and durability in their products.

Adhesive Source: Waterborne (Dominant) vs. Solvent-borne (Emerging)

Waterborne adhesives are characterized by their reliance on water as the primary solvent, making them a cleaner choice for manufacturers while delivering strong bonding performance. This segment is predominant in the market, favored for its compliance with environmental regulations and its appeal to eco-conscious consumers. Conversely, solvent-borne adhesives are emerging due to their effectiveness in demanding applications. They offer superior bonding capabilities in extreme conditions but come with higher VOC emissions. As regulatory frameworks evolve, solvent-borne adhesives are adapting, with manufacturers investing in technologies that reduce environmental impacts, thus positioning them for growth even as the market shifts towards more sustainable options.

Polyurethane (Dominant) vs. Acrylic (Emerging)

Polyurethane adhesives stand out as the dominant type in the US flock adhesives market, characterized by their exceptional strength and versatility, making them ideal for a wide range of applications, particularly in the automotive and textile industries. Known for their excellent bonding properties, Polyurethane adhesives can withstand varying environmental conditions, contributing to their robust market position. On the other hand, Acrylic adhesives are emerging rapidly, gaining traction due to their quicker curing times and adaptability, which appeals to manufacturers seeking efficiency and sustainability in production processes. As industries increasingly pivot towards eco-friendly solutions, Acrylic is positioned to capitalize on this trend, marking its footprint as an innovative choice for future applications.
